What is a street performer?
A street performer, often referred to as a busker, is an artist who performs in public spaces, typically for tips or donations. These performances can include music, dance, theater, or visual art, and they aim to entertain and engage passersby.
How can I support street performers?
You can support street performers by showing appreciation for their work. This could involve giving them tips, sharing their performances on social media, or simply clapping and cheering to encourage their craft. Engaging with them directly can also create a sense of community and connection.
Are street performances legal in New York City?
Yes, street performances are generally legal in New York City; however, performers must adhere to certain regulations such as not blocking pedestrian traffic or using amplified sound systems without permits. Each borough may have specific location rules, so it’s essential for performers to stay informed.
